    • @nickridley967
      @nickridley967 2 ปีที่แล้ว +24

      @@KHAMLOTK When faced with an emergency situation where hard braking is necessary; straighten the handlebar and apply BOTH brakes at the same time, coming to a controlled stop. Braking in a curve is never a good idea but is often necessary. Always use the back brake if braking is necessary in a curve. In this case he shouldn’t have been riding like a maniac but if he wanted to save his bike he should have performed an emergency brake and quickly maneuvered out of traffic.

    @TerryMasri 2 ปีที่แล้ว +7

    I once suffered the exact same fate in Downtown San Diego while riding my 1986 Honda CB750SC Nighthawk in city traffic. I got distracted for a fraction of a second before realizing that the pickup truck in front of me came to a sudden stop at a red light. I panicked and slammed on my front brakes causing the front wheel to slip from under me. I ended-up sliding along with the bike underneath the pickup truck I was avoiding to hit, which actually served me well. The pickup truck was high enough that neither the bike nor I came in contact with it. Luckily, I was going much slower then the guy in this video and I had my helmet and leather jacket on. The bike only sustained a broken turn signal light and I suffered a few scratches on my hand and a bruised ego. The driver of the car in front of me didn't even realize anything happened behind him.

    @89kyleeb 2 ปีที่แล้ว +18

    Definitely a new rider on a new bike. If you pause at 2:34 and look at that foot peg and brake it looks like they're positioned to be used with higher bars. I would be really surprised if he was able to quickly and effectively move his foot up to the brake when the time came. There's a reason people building cafes and bobbers put rear sets on when running lower bars or clip-ons.

    • @Ishbikes
      @Ishbikes ปีที่แล้ว

      It’s an 883. Of course he’s a new rider.. Harley dudes wouldn’t spend money on an 883 UNLESS it was their first bike.

    • @louisgunn7314
      @louisgunn7314 ปีที่แล้ว

      An 883 doesn't come with forward foot controls. It's mid controls from the factory. Also, doesn't have a drag bar for the handlebars. So, it's put on after you buy it. He also had aftermarket exhaust,cuz it doesn't sound like that, and after market air filter. I think it's very uncomfortable to have forward controls and drag bars.

    • @rustyshackleford5509
      @rustyshackleford5509 ปีที่แล้ว

      the bike definitely needed mid-controls, a lot of motorcycle steering ability comes from using your hips to shift your weight side to side, but you can't do that with forward controls.
